kontrollera en lampa med datorn?

Här pratar vi programmering i dessa olika former. Perl, C/C++, Pascal, ADA, Lisp, COBOL, ZX Basic och mm.
Post Reply
diddi
Posts: 231
Joined: 11 August 2003, 19:42
Contact:

kontrollera en lampa med datorn?

Post by diddi » 12 April 2005, 00:17

Hejsan!

Jag satt och hade tråkigt, då jag fick en liten fixidé.... om det nu är möjligt vet jag inte, men om jag inte misstar mig så har jag för mig att detta redan är gjort.

Det jag vill skapa, är en lampa, eller en annan liknande elektronisk enhet som kan styras genom ex. pralell porten (eller vad som nu är lämpligast).

Programmeringen sker i Visual Basic 6.0 (kanske inte det bästa språket, men det är vad som står till buds).

Tanken är att man ska på något vis kunna styra först och främst "on/off", och sedan kanske lite utöver det.

Visste inte var jag skulle posta detta, men då det var en del programmering fick det bli här. Skulle dock vara bussigt med en del hjälp vad gäller skapandet av enheten (troligen en lampa) och dess anslutning.

Ja, detta är en läxa jag fått (därför enbart Visual Basic får användas), jag har tidigare erfarenheter av programmering, men dock inte på denna nivå. Vore kul att ge det ett försök åtminstonde!
Kom gärna med förslag om var jag ska ta vägen, vet inte riktigt vad jag letar efter =)
/Diddi

User avatar
Jan Pihlgren
Posts: 1447
Joined: 22 April 2002, 02:00
Location: MÄRSTA
Contact:

Post by Jan Pihlgren » 12 April 2005, 04:51

Läxor löser man själv.

diddi
Posts: 231
Joined: 11 August 2003, 19:42
Contact:

Post by diddi » 12 April 2005, 07:21

Jan Pihlgren wrote:Läxor löser man själv.
Så du menar att du gick igenom hela din skolgång, eller fortfarande går den helt utan lärare?
Oavsett vilket problem det än är, om det är ett problem du finner i vardagen, eller om det är en läxa du fått av en lärare, så Kan Du Inte lösa den om du inte har den blekaste aning om var du ska börja!
En liten knuff i rätt riktning är allt jag ber om.

Har du ingenting vettigare att komma med, var vänlig håll tyst! Åtminstonde i mina trådar.
/Diddi

zebastian
Posts: 297
Joined: 2 April 2002, 02:00
Location: Bromma
Contact:

Post by zebastian » 12 April 2005, 07:36

Senaste numret av Datormagazin har en artikel över ämnet.

Agitator[RoX]
Posts: 3416
Joined: 19 September 2002, 17:35
Location: Kalmar
Contact:

Post by Agitator[RoX] » 12 April 2005, 08:25

diddi wrote:
Jan Pihlgren wrote:Läxor löser man själv.
Så du menar att du gick igenom hela din skolgång, eller fortfarande går den helt utan lärare?
Oavsett vilket problem det än är, om det är ett problem du finner i vardagen, eller om det är en läxa du fått av en lärare, så Kan Du Inte lösa den om du inte har den blekaste aning om var du ska börja!
En liten knuff i rätt riktning är allt jag ber om.

Har du ingenting vettigare att komma med, var vänlig håll tyst! Åtminstonde i mina trådar.
Men vi löser inte läxproblem åt folk här.. Kan ge tips m.m. dock...
Ska det vara en vanlig lampa kan en styrkrets som kan slås av och på med låga spänningar vara bra.. Sedan är det bara att köra på paralelle eller comporten.. Koppla den till relät och tja.. skicka en puls när du vill tända/släcka?
Gamma Testing - Where testing is extended to the entire user community (AKA shipping the product)

User avatar
Tronic
Posts: 172
Joined: 20 February 2004, 17:11
Location: Karlskoga

Post by Tronic » 12 April 2005, 09:04

http://www.xstore.se/html/artikel/9697.html

Det där kanske vore nått ;)
Om man har pengarna liggandes nånstanns.

oldis
Posts: 35
Joined: 4 September 2002, 13:10
Location: Skövde

Post by oldis » 12 April 2005, 10:52

Det är bara att börja från början: sök info själv :D

Det tog mig ungefär 30 sekunder att googla fram denna sida:
http://hem.passagen.se/klahr/PARALL.HTM

Sedan är det bara att leta reda på ett exempel på hur man programmerar parallellporten i VB istället för i C++ eller QBasic.

Hasseman
Posts: 964
Joined: 17 May 2003, 22:56
Location: Alingsås
Contact:

Post by Hasseman » 12 April 2005, 20:18

Skall du styra elektoniska enheter som kräver mer än 5v drivspänning så kan jag rekomendera att använda paralellporten till att styra någon form av relä som i sin tur styr själva kretsen. Det kan ju annars bli svårt att driva kaffebryggaren mha paralellporten :)

Vad gäller sökandet efter information så kommer jag ihåg att jag gjorde något liknande för 100år sedan med Visual Basic och då räkte det inbyggda hjälpsystemet till aldeles utmärkt.
Share the penguin and If you do, lucky end for them and you.

//hasseman

Lucifer888
Posts: 4111
Joined: 3 February 2003, 12:18
Location: Stockholm

Post by Lucifer888 » 12 April 2005, 21:03

Fundersam, hur farligt är det för datorn att göra sådant. Dvs löda egna enheter som anslutes till com/usb/parallell-port. Hur mycket på datorn kan "förstöras" av det? t ex kortslutas
"It's not that I hate people, I just think they're all idiots"
"Långt hår kräver mycket näring, framhålls det, och berövar hjärnan energi."

mikma
Posts: 3349
Joined: 10 July 2003, 21:19

Post by mikma » 12 April 2005, 22:07

Jag upptäckte nyligen "Project NEXA" som jag tycker verkar intressant, men jag vet inte om just de radiostyrda strömbrytarna säljs längre.

http://www.mellander.org/per/projects/?project=nexa

Hasseman
Posts: 964
Joined: 17 May 2003, 22:56
Location: Alingsås
Contact:

Post by Hasseman » 13 April 2005, 09:39

mikma wrote:Jag upptäckte nyligen "Project NEXA" som jag tycker verkar intressant, men jag vet inte om just de radiostyrda strömbrytarna säljs längre.

http://www.mellander.org/per/projects/?project=nexa
Hah..... Undra bara hur stor risk det är att råka ut för hackare som kapar kaffebryggaren. :P
Share the penguin and If you do, lucky end for them and you.

//hasseman

OErjan
Posts: 1834
Joined: 21 April 2003, 06:43
Location: 64*N 21*E

Post by OErjan » 13 April 2005, 21:06

jag har gjort lite sånthär, har "bränt" en par serieportar med felkopplingar (3 på 10 år), men IO kort är inte så dyra. skulle iofs kunna bli värre...
kanske jag är en av de sista människor som ser din gamla: bil, dator, gräsklippare...
efter mig är de så många kilo konfetti.

uffe_nordholm
Posts: 52
Joined: 19 January 2003, 19:36

Post by uffe_nordholm » 13 April 2005, 21:29

Ett tips är väl att köpa ett extra kort med parallelportar, så att om man bränner något är det inte det som är inbyggt i moderkortet som ryker. När det sedan gäller att styra reläer kan det behövas någon strömförstärkare (mao bufferkrets) för att reläerna skall reagera. Dessutom bör du ha dioder parallelt med varje reläspole (i 'bak-o-fram-riktning) för att inte bränna drivkretsarna när du slår av reläerna.

Staffan V
Posts: 27
Joined: 13 August 2003, 11:51
Location: Stockholm
Contact:

Post by Staffan V » 18 April 2005, 16:00

Sedan finns det iofs specialkort med reläer. Då får man oftast med ett SDK man kan använda.

Post Reply